##// END OF EJS Templates
cleanupnodes: pass multiple predecessors to `createmarkers` directly
Boris Feld -
r39959:61f39a89 default
parent child Browse files
Show More
@@ -984,9 +984,8 b' def cleanupnodes(repo, replacements, ope'
984 sortfunc = lambda ns: torev(ns[0][0])
984 sortfunc = lambda ns: torev(ns[0][0])
985 rels = []
985 rels = []
986 for ns, s in sorted(replacements.items(), key=sortfunc):
986 for ns, s in sorted(replacements.items(), key=sortfunc):
987 for n in ns:
987 rel = (tuple(unfi[n] for n in ns), tuple(unfi[m] for m in s))
988 rel = (unfi[n], tuple(unfi[m] for m in s))
988 rels.append(rel)
989 rels.append(rel)
990 if rels:
989 if rels:
991 obsolete.createmarkers(repo, rels, operation=operation,
990 obsolete.createmarkers(repo, rels, operation=operation,
992 metadata=metadata)
991 metadata=metadata)
General Comments 0
You need to be logged in to leave comments. Login now